It shows the recording started but not records it . also the ts file name is 0 kb.<br>is there a vdr problem or copy protected channell?<br><br><br>> Date: Sun, 26 Apr 2009 12:19:07 +0200<br>> From: Klaus.Schmidinger@cadsoft.de<br>> To: vdr@linuxtv.org<br>> Subject: [vdr] [ANNOUNCE] VDR developer version 1.7.6<br>> <br>> VDR developer version 1.7.6 is now available at<br>> <br>> ftp://ftp.cadsoft.de/vdr/Developer/vdr-1.7.6.tar.bz2<br>> <br>> A 'diff' against the previous version is available at<br>> <br>> ftp://ftp.cadsoft.de/vdr/Developer/vdr-1.7.5-1.7.6.diff<br>> <br>> <br>> <br>> WARNING:<br>> ========<br>> <br>> This is a *developer* version. Even though *I* use it in my productive<br>> environment. I strongly recommend that you only use it under controlled<br>> conditions and for testing and debugging.<br>> <br>> <br>> <br>> IMPORTANT:<br>> ==========<br>> <br>> If you use a full featured DVB card for replay you need the DVB driver<br>> version from<br>> <br>> http://linuxtv.org/hg/~endriss/v4l-dvb<br>> <br>> in order to replay TS recordings!<br>> Users of full featured DVB cards also need to use a new firmware,<br>> available at<br>> <br>> http://www.escape-edv.de/endriss/firmware<br>> <br>> <br>> Note that the header files in the latest driver versions may be broken.<br>> If you get compiler error messages like<br>> <br>> /usr/include/sys/types.h:52: error: conflicting declaration 'typedef __ino64_t ino_t'<br>> /usr/include/linux/types.h:14: error: 'ino_t' has a previous declaration as 'typedef __kernel_ino_t ino_t'<br>> <br>> when compiling VDR, you need to put the driver header files back to<br>> how they were before they got broken. One way of doing this is to<br>> apply the patch from<br>> <br>> ftp://ftp.cadsoft.de/vdr/Developer/v4l-dvb-header-fix.diff<br>> <br>> (I'm not claiming that this is the right way to fix this, since the driver<br>> developers may have had good reasons for making that change. However, both<br>> the driver and VDR compile and work fine with this).<br>> <br>> <br>> <br>> The changes since version 1.7.5:<br>> <br>> - cDevice::PlayTs() now syncs on the TS packet sync bytes.<br>> - Made MAXFRAMESIZE a multiple of TS_SIZE to avoid breaking up TS packets.<br>> - No longer resetting the patPmtParser in cDevice::PlayTs(), because this<br>> caused the selected audio and subtitle tracks to fall back to the default.<br>> - The SVDRP command PUTE now supports reading the EPG data from a given file<br>> (thanks to Helmut Auer).<br>> - Added cThread::SetIOPriority() and using it in cRemoveDeletedRecordingsThread<br>> (thanks to Rolf Ahrenberg).<br>> - Fixed the MEGABYTE() macro to make it correctly handle parameters resulting in<br>> values larger than 2GB.<br>> - Added cDevice::NumProvidedSystems() to PLUGINS.html (was missing since it had<br>> been implemented).<br>> - Fixed distortions when switching to the next file during replay.<br>> - Fixed detecting the frame rate for streams with PTS distances of 1800, which<br>> apparently split one frame over two payload units.<br>> - Added missing 'const' to cRecording::FramesPerSecond() (thanks to Joachim Wilke).<br>> - Any TS packets in the first "frame" after a cut in an edited recording that don't<br>> belong to a payload unit that started in that frame now get their TEI flag set,<br>> so that a decoder will ignore them together with any PES data collected for that<br>> PID so far (thanks to Oliver Endriss for reporting chirping sound disturbences at<br>> editing points in TS recordings).<br>> - cDvbPlayer::Empty() subtracts 1 from readIndex, because Action() will first<br>> increment it.<br>> - Only storing non-zero Pts values in ptsIndex.<br>> - Added a note to the INSTALL file about using subdirectories to split a large<br>> disk into separate areas for VDR's video data and other stuff (suggested by<br>> Udo Richter).<br>> <br>> Have fun!<br>> <br>> Klaus<br>> <br>> _______________________________________________<br>> vdr mailing list<br>> vdr@linuxtv.org<br>> http://www.linuxtv.org/cgi-bin/mailman/listinfo/vdr<br><br /><hr />Diğer Windows Live™ özelliklerine göz atın. <a href='http://www.microsoft.com/windows/windowslive/' target='_new'>Sadece e-posta iletilerinden daha fazlası </a></body>
